Abstract

The utility model discloses an automatic discharging system. The automatic discharging system comprises a discharging platform, supporting frames, a hydraulic transmission system, a supporting leg seat, check stopping blocks and ground supports. The tail end of the discharging platform is connected with the a set of the ground supports in a hinge joint mode and arranged in a pit, the check stopping blocks for allowing wheels of a trailer to stop are further arranged on the upper surface of the discharging platform, a set of the supporting frames are welded with the discharging platform to form a whole, attached to the two side faces of the discharging platform, and stretch upwards, and the hydraulic transmission system ejects the supporting frames to drive the discharging platform to rotate and lift. The discharging platform with the supporting frame structure is utilized to be matched with the hydraulic transmission system, the automatic discharging system has the advantages of being reliable in structure and high in stability, a container wagon or a general wagon without the self discharging function can be quickly discharged, then during the discharging operation, the container wagon does not need to be separated from a traction headstock of the container wagon and the general wagon does not need to be separated from a traction headstock of the general wagon, discharging operation can be safely and stably completed, and therefore transportation logistics cost is greatly reduced.

Background technology
In the prior art, the container bulk material discharging has four kinds of methods, for example, a kind of be with freight container from the superimposed trailer ground of hanging oneself, tear open with artificial or mechanical equipment inlet and to dig, dumping time is long, work efficiency is low; Another kind is to utilize a sling end of freight container of hoisting crane, and other end invariant position forms the inclination angle, makes the free landing of bulk cargo, needs outfit large lifting equipment and complex operation; The third method is to adopt self-discharging semitrailer to carry out the transportation of freight container, and discharging relies on the ability of vehicle itself that freight container is tilted, and makes the free landing of bulk cargo, and the container lorry price with self-unloading function is high, has increased traffic cost and dumping car use cost; Secondly, be on freight container is hung oneself the unloading goods inside container platform from superimposed trailer, by the platform bumping post freight container to be blocked rear platform and tilt bulk cargo is poured out, each discharging all needs to operate back and forth tractor truck, and dumping time significantly increases.

Please in conjunction with illustrated in figures 1 and 2, it is a kind of automatic discharging system structural representation and birds-eye view under off working state, described automatic discharging system comprises: discharging platform 1, bracing frame 2, power hydraulic system 3, supporting leg seat 4, stop bit block 5 and ground support 6, wherein
Discharging platform 1 tail end and one group of ground support 6 chain connection are arranged in the melt pit, discharging platform 1 upper surface also is provided with the stop bit block 5 of stopping for trailer wheels, these stop bit block 5 quantity can be set to one or more, stop bit block 5 is provided with arcwall face and has magnetic force, be positioned at trailer rear wheel place in the present embodiment and establish one group of stop bit block 5, the front vehicle wheel place establishes a stop bit block 5, and trailer wheel is close to the arcwall face of stop bit block 5 and passes through the magnetic attraction tire, to supply reliably the car body axial limiting;
One group of bracing frame 2 and discharging platform 1 are integrally welded and fit in discharging platform 1 two sides and extend upward setting; preferably; support frame as described above is made as " A " word bracing frame 2; " A " word bracing frame 2 comprises: some hold-down arms 21 and top crossbeam 22; the head end of this hold-down arm 21 is welded in and consists of the jacking support frame on the top crossbeam 22; " A " word bracing frame 2 is set up in the stage body middle part of discharging platform 1; " A " word bracing frame 2 structures of three hold-down arms 21 have been provided in the present embodiment; itself and discharging platform 1 in a certain angle the setting form approximate " A " word steelframe; this bracing frame 2 also can be not limited to this " A " font support frame; as long as can be effective; stably realize the supporting construction of hydraulic efficiency pressure system top lift; all in protection domain of the present utility model; wherein; also be understandable that; this hold-down arm 21 and top crossbeam 22 can adopt for example i-beam structure setting; steel structure support arm 21; crossbeam 22 concrete sizes in top can be checked its Rigidity and strength by bearing load and determined, repeat no more herein." A " word bracing frame 2 structures arrange simple and can bear larger load, so that should " A " word bracing frame 2 can be effectively, the stable top lift that bears multi-stage telescopic hydraulic actuating cylinder 31 and load-carrying, and then hold up trailer or the general wagon rotation discharging that is loaded with freight container 9.
Power hydraulic system 3 comprises: multi-stage telescopic hydraulic actuating cylinder 31, Hydraulic Pump 32, control box 33, fuel tank, and energy storage, pipeline, by-pass valve control etc., wherein, described multi-stage telescopic hydraulic actuating cylinder 31 bottom chain connections are on supporting leg seat 4, and multi-stage telescopic hydraulic actuating cylinder 31 tops and support frame as described above 2 top chain connections, control box 33 control Hydraulic Pumps 32 turn round to control 31 elongations of multi-stage telescopic hydraulic actuating cylinder and come jacking to support 2, and then with trailer around the hinge-point of discharging platform 1 and 6 formation of bottom surface bearing rotation lifting, can successfully realize docking of freight container 9 or container and reception hopper.
Discharging platform 1 upper surface also is provided with the lock dog 7 for the lock hanging of tractor conduction chain, and when the automatic discharging system mode of operation, these lock dog 7 latch hooks are lived tractor, further promote the automatic discharging system operating safety factor; The bottom surface of discharging platform 1 also is provided with some discharging platform bearings 8, supports and horizontal positioned to guarantee discharging platform 1.
As can be known be, the utility model automatic discharging system is applicable to the general wagon that does not have self-discharging, perhaps being loaded with freight container 9 lorries unloads automatically, and needn't require trailer to separate with tractor can automatically to unload, so that the discharge operation change is easy, and adapt to all kinds of load-carrying car bodies, have wide range of applications.
Please be simultaneously in conjunction with structural representation under the automatic discharging system mode of operation shown in Figure 3, this automatic discharging system working process is specific as follows: trailer or the general wagon that will be loaded with freight container 9 sail on the discharging platform 1, lock dog 7 latch hooks are lived tractor, and trailer wheels is near stop bit block 5.Connect working power, power hydraulic system 3 work this moment, driven by motor Hydraulic Pump 32 work in the control box 33, Hydraulic Pump 32 is converted into hydraulic energy with mechanical energy, with the hydraulic oil in the fuel tank by the road, flow control valve changes hydraulic oil and flows to, so that pressure oil arrives multi-stage telescopic hydraulic actuating cylinder 6 in-lines, press control box 33 interior rising buttons, connect the large oil pocket oil circuit of high pressure oil in the multi-stage telescopic hydraulic actuating cylinder 6, and connect simultaneously the small oil cavity of multi-stage telescopic hydraulic actuating cylinder 6 and the oil circuit of oil sump tank, the piston rod of multi-stage telescopic hydraulic actuating cylinder 6 begins elongation, when the hinge-point that multi-stage telescopic hydraulic actuating cylinder 6 bottoms form around itself and supporting leg seat 4 rotates, piston rod elongation jacking bracing frame 2 rotates, and then so that discharging platform 1 rotates rising around the hinge-point with ground support 6 formation, and the anglec of rotation can reach and become 0 °~65 ° angles with horizontal surface, after reaching the self-unloading inclination angle, realizes bulk cargo the automatic landing of bulk cargo, press control box 33 interior stop buttons this moment, make discharging platform 1 keep constant with the inclination angle of horizontal surface, allow material unsnatch;
When resetting, press control box 10 interior decline buttons, the multiway valve oil return line is communicated with large oil pocket in the multi-stage telescopic hydraulic actuating cylinder 31, and multiway valve mesohigh oil communicates with small oil cavity in the multi-stage telescopic hydraulic actuating cylinder 31, multi-stage telescopic hydraulic actuating cylinder 31 shrinks under trailer deadweight and oil pressure double action, discharging platform 1 descends around the hinge-point rotation with ground support 6 formation, after discharging platform 1 is horizontal, press stop button in the control box 33, close at last power source, disconnect external power, whole self-unloading process is complete.
Wherein, the exportable large thrust that power hydraulic system 3 in the utility model has and large torque; can realize the motion of low speed large-tonnage; infinite speed variation; and hydraulic efficiency gear has, and volume is little, lightweight, the characteristics of compact conformation; 31 motions of multi-stage telescopic hydraulic actuating cylinder are very uniform and stable; and speed of response is fast; the automation that is easy to realize automatic discharging system is used in uniting with mechanical, electrical device simultaneously; also be convenient to realize overload protection; use safety, reliable, be convenient to the plurality of advantages that designs, make, keep in repair and promote the use of so this automatic discharging system has.
